Custom Application Development – Bit Lake Lab

Custom Software

Software Built
Around
Your Business

Off-the-shelf tools force you to adapt your workflows. We build the system that fits exactly how your organization operates.

Tailored to Your Workflows Scalable Architecture Secure by Design
Discuss Your Project
Custom application development
Hero Image

What Is It?

Software Designed
From Scratch
for You

A custom application is software built specifically for your company — matching your workflows, your business logic, and your integration needs. Not a template. Not a subscription tool you adapt to. Yours.

Because it’s built for your organization, it can evolve alongside your business and adapt to future needs — something generic software can never do.

Common Examples

Internal Management Systems
Customer Portals
Workflow Automation Platforms
Data Dashboards & Reporting
Operational Tracking Systems
Integration Platforms

Development Process

How We Build
Your Application

A structured, transparent process from the first conversation to launch day — and beyond.

01 Requirements & Planning We analyze your business processes, user types, integration needs, security requirements, and scalability goals to design the right technical architecture.
02 System Architecture Design Backend infrastructure, database structure, security layers, API communication, and performance strategies are planned before a single line of code is written.
03 Backend & Frontend Development The backend handles data processing, business rules, and security. The frontend delivers an intuitive, responsive interface that works across all devices.
04 Database Implementation A properly designed database configured for structured storage, fast queries, data integrity, and secure access controls — built to grow with your data.
05 Authentication & Security User accounts, role-based access controls, secure data handling, and protection against unauthorized access built into every layer of the system.
06 External Integrations Connection to payment platforms, third-party tools, data services, communication systems, and enterprise software — making your app part of a larger ecosystem.
07 Admin Control Panel An internal dashboard to manage users, monitor data, control workflows, configure settings, and review activity — without requiring technical intervention.
08 Documentation Clear technical and functional documentation delivered so the system can be understood, maintained, and expanded by your team over time.
09 Deployment & Launch Server configuration, installation, database setup, security hardening, and final verification — the system goes live fully operational and ready for users.

Built-In Capabilities

Every System Comes
Production-Ready

No shortcuts. Every application we build includes a solid technical foundation across all critical areas.

Scalable Database

Designed for structured storage, fast retrieval, and reliability as your data volume grows.

Security & Access Control

Authentication, role-based permissions, and secure data handling built into every layer.

API & Integrations

Connect with payment platforms, business tools, data services, and enterprise systems.

Responsive Interface

Intuitive, device-agnostic frontend designed for the actual users who interact with the system daily.

Admin Control Panel

Full management dashboard for users, data, workflows, and system configuration — no technical knowledge required.

Full Documentation

Technical and functional documentation delivered at launch so the system can be maintained and expanded over time.

Custom software benefits
Section Image

Why Custom?

Technology That
Works for You

Most software is built for everyone — which means it’s optimized for no one. Generic tools require your team to change how they work to fit the software’s limitations.

Custom software inverts this. The system is shaped around your processes, your data, and your team — and it grows as your business grows.

“Instead of adapting your business to fit the tool, the tool adapts to fit your business.”

The foundation of custom software development

Ongoing Support

Your Application
Always Running

Software doesn’t stop needing attention after launch. Our maintenance plan keeps the system secure, performant, and evolving alongside your business.

Application Monitoring

Continuous monitoring to detect issues early and keep the system stable and responsive.

System Backups

Regular backups of data and configurations — allowing fast recovery if something unexpected happens.

Security Updates

Security practices evolve constantly. Updates are applied to maintain protection against new vulnerabilities.

Bug Fixes

Errors and unexpected behaviors are identified and corrected to maintain a smooth user experience.

Performance Optimization

Periodic improvements to increase speed, efficiency, and reliability as usage and data grow.

Ongoing Improvements

Dedicated development time each month to add new features or improve existing functionality as your needs evolve.

Ready to Build?

Let’s Build the System
Your Business Needs

Tell us about your operational challenge and we’ll design a custom solution that fits — not a generic tool that almost fits.

Built for your workflows Scalable from day one Ongoing support available
Discuss Your Project No commitment · Response within 24h